Does it matter if you have a spider mole with normal liver function?

If your liver function is normal, it is normal for you to have spider moles and it does not matter. Some pregnant women and women in puberty are also very likely to suffer from this disease, which is a normal phenomenon. 1. Adolescent girls: some girls in adolescence, because they are in the peak stage of growth and development, there is a large amount of estrogen in the body, so the chances of spider nevi are relatively large, but this is a normal physiological phenomenon, do not have to be treated, with the continuous growth of age, estrogen secretion is slowly reduced, the spider nevus will gradually disappear. 2. Pregnant women: spider nevus is caused by excessive estrogen, and estrogen in pregnant women’s body will increase significantly, so some pregnant women will also appear spider nevus on the skin, and most of them will appear in 2~5 months after pregnancy, but there is no need for special treatment, and it can disappear on its own after a few months after delivery. If spider nevus appears and the above conditions are excluded, it is recommended to consult a doctor in time to see if there is any abnormality in liver function, and the problem should be treated in time.
